Dunblane is one of Central Scotland’s most desirable locations - a charming and historic city that offers an exceptional quality of life. Its city status stems from the striking 13th-century Cathedral, a proud centrepiece that reflects Dunblane’s rich heritage and enduring appeal.
The town provides all the essentials for daily living, with a variety of local shops, a library, post office, and healthcare services, including a medical centre. Supermarkets such as Tesco and M&S Foodhall are within easy reach, making everyday errands simple and convenient.
Families are drawn to the area for its well-regarded schools at both primary and secondary level, while a strong sense of community is supported by a wide range of local clubs, groups, and activities.
For leisure and recreation, residents can enjoy riverside walks, a local golf course, tennis club, and the popular Dunblane Centre, which hosts fitness classes, youth programmes, and community events. The Hydro Hotel, a well-known local landmark, also offers access to a leisure club, spa, and restaurant.
Dunblane’s cafés, restaurants, and pubs create a relaxed and sociable atmosphere, and the town’s compact size makes everything easily accessible on foot. Excellent transport links include a mainline railway station with direct services to Stirling, Glasgow, Edinburgh and beyond, while the city of Stirling is just a 10-minute drive away. All of this combines to make Dunblane a consistently popular choice for buyers looking for the best of town and country living.
